1 Yesuus barattoota isaatiin akkana jedhe; “Namicha sooressa nama hojii isaa adeemsisuuf qabu tokkotu ture; akka hojii adeemsisaan sun qabeenya isaa jalaa balleessaa jirus sooressa sanatti himan.
Then He said further to His disciples: “There was a certain rich man who had a manager, who was accused to him of wasting his goods.
2 Sooressi sunis hojii adeemsisaa sana ofitti waamee, ‘Wanni ani waaʼee kee dhagaʼu kun maalii? Ati siʼachi waan hojii adeemsisaa taʼuu hin dandeenyeef, hojii adeemsisaa turte sana irratti gabaasa naa dhiʼeessi’ jedheen.
So he called him in and said to him: ‘What is this I hear about you? Render an account of your stewardship, because you can no longer be manager.’
3 “Hojii adeemsisaan sunis garaa isaa keessatti akkana jedhe; ‘Waan gooftaan koo hojii keessaa na baasuuf, maal naa wayya? Lafa qotuuf humna hin qabu; kadhachuu immoo nan qaanaʼa.
Then the manager said within himself: ‘What shall I do? My master is taking the management away from me. I do not have strength to dig; I am ashamed to beg
4 Akka yeroo ani hojii keessaa ariʼamutti namoonni mana isaaniitti na simataniif waanan godhu anuu beeka.’
—I know what I will do, so that whenever I am removed from the management they may receive me into their houses.’
5 “Innis warra gatiin gooftaa isaa irra jiru tokko tokkoon waamee, isa jalqabaatiin, ‘Idaan gooftaa koo hammamitu sirra jira?’ jedhee gaafate.
Summoning each one of his master's debtors, he said to the first, ‘How much do you owe my master?’
6 “Namichis, ‘Zayitii ejersaa hubboo dhibba saddeeti’ jedhee deebise. “Hojii adeemsisaan sunis, ‘Waraqaa walii galtee kee hooʼu; dafii taaʼiitii dhibba afur jedhii barreessi’ jedheen.
And he said, ‘A hundred baths of olive oil.’ So he said to him, ‘Take your bill and sit down quickly and write fifty.’
7 “Isa lammaffaadhaanis, ‘Sirra immoo hammamitu jira?’ jedhee gaafate. “Innis, ‘Qamadii guuboo kuma tokkoo’ jedheen. “Hojii adeemsisaan sunis, ‘Waraqaa walii galtee kee hooʼuutii, 80 jedhii barreessi’ jedheen.
Then he said to another, ‘And how much do you owe?’ And he said, ‘A hundred measures of wheat.’ So he said to him, ‘Take your bill and write eighty.’
8 “Hojii adeemsisaan hin amanamne sun waan abshaala taʼeef gooftichi isa jaje; namoonni addunyaa kanaa warra akka isaanii wajjin haajaa isaanii guutachuu irratti namoota ifaa caalaa abshaalotaatii. (aiōn g165)
The master even ‘commended’ the dishonest manager, because he had acted shrewdly. The sons of this age are shrewder in their own generation than the sons of the Light. (aiōn g165)
9 Ani isinittin hima; akka isaan yeroo qabeenyi sun dhumutti mana bara baraatti isin simataniif qabeenya addunyaatiin ofii keessaniif michoota horadhaa. (aiōnios g166)
“I even say to you, make friends for yourselves by means of unrighteous mammon, so that whenever you fail, they may receive you into the eternal dwellings! (aiōnios g166)
10 “Namni waan xinnootti amanamu kam iyyuu waan baayʼeettis ni amanama; namni waan xinnootti hin amanamne kam iyyuu immoo waan baayʼeettis hin amanamu.
He who is faithful in a very little is faithful also in much, and he who is dishonest in a very little is dishonest also in much.
11 Yoos isin yoo qabeenya addunyaatti hin amanamne, qabeenya dhugaatti immoo eenyutu isin amana ree?
If therefore you have not been faithful with the unrighteous mammon, who will commit to your trust the genuine?
12 Yoo isin qabeenya nama biraa irratti hin amanamne, qabeenya mataa keessanii immoo eenyutu isinii kenna ree?
And if you have not been faithful in what belongs to another, who will give you what is your own?
13 “Namni gooftota lama tajaajiluu dandaʼu tokko iyyuu hin jiru. Isa tokko jibbitee isa kaan jaallattaatii; yookaan isa tokkoof of kennitee isa kaan immoo tuffatta. Isinis Waaqaa fi maallaqa tajaajiluu hin dandeessan.”
No servant can serve two masters; either he will hate the one and love the other, or he will be devoted to the one and despise the other. You cannot serve God and mammon!”
14 Fariisonni warri maallaqa jaallatan waan kana hunda dhagaʼanii Yesuusitti qoosan.
Now the Pharisees, who were lovers of money, were also listening to all these things, and they were ridiculing Him.
15 Innis akkana isaaniin jedhe; “Isin warra fuula namootaa duratti qajeeltota of gootanii dha; Waaqni garuu garaa keessan beeka. Wanni nama biratti akka malee kabajamu fuula Waaqaa duratti jibbisiisaadhaatii.
So He said to them: “You are those who justify yourselves before men, but God knows your hearts. That which is exalted among men is an abomination before God.
16 “Seerrii fi raajonni hamma Yohannisitti labsaman. Yeroo sanaa jalqabee wangeelli mootummaa Waaqaa lallabamaa jira; namni hundinuus itti galuuf wal dhiiba.
The Law and the Prophets were until John; since then the Kingdom of God is being proclaimed, and every one is trying to force his way into it.
17 Seera keessaa tuqaan hundumaa gadii dhabamuu irra samii fi lafti dhabamuutu salphata.
But it is easier for heaven and earth to pass away, than for one tittle of the Law to fail.
18 “Namni niitii isaa hiikee dubartii biraa fuudhu kam iyyuu ejja raawwata; namni dubartii dhirsa ishee hiikte fuudhus ejja raawwata.
“Whoever divorces his wife and marries another woman commits adultery, and whoever marries her who is divorced from her husband commits adultery.
19 “Namicha sooressa uffata dhiilgee haphii kan quncee talbaa irraa hojjetame uffatee, guyyuma guyyaan qananiidhaan jiraatu tokkotu ture.
“Now there was a certain rich man who was dressed in purple and fine linen, living in luxury every day.
20 Karra isaa dura immoo namichi hiyyeessi Alʼaazaar jedhamu kan dhagni isaa hundi mammadaaʼe tokko ciisaa ture.
And there was a certain beggar named Lazarus, covered with sores, who had been placed at his gate,
21 Innis hambaa maaddii sooressa sanaa irraa harcaʼu illee nyaachuu ni kajeela ture; saroonni iyyuu dhufanii madaa isaa arraabu turan.
just wanting to be fed with the crumbs that fell from the rich man's table—why even the dogs would come and lick his sores!
22 “Gaaf tokko namichi hiyyeessi sun duunaan ergamoonni Waaqaa isa baatanii gara bobaa Abrahaamitti isa geessan; sooressichis duʼee awwaalame.
In due time the beggar died and was carried away to Abraham's bosom by the angels. “The rich man also died and was buried.
23 Utuu Siiʼool keessatti dhiphachaa jiruus ol milʼatee Abrahaamin fagootti, Alʼaazaarin immoo bobaa Abrahaam keessatti arge. (Hadēs g86)
And in Hades he looked up and saw Abraham at a distance, and Lazarus very close to him. And being in torment, (Hadēs g86)
24 Innis iyyee, ‘Yaa Abbaa koo Abrahaam, waan ani ibidda kana keessatti dhiphachaa jiruuf maaloo garaa naa laafiitii akka inni fiixee quba isaa bishaan keessa cuuphee arraba koo naa qabbaneessuuf Alʼaazaarin naa ergi’ jedheen.
he called out, saying, ‘Father Abraham, have mercy on me and send Lazarus, that he may dip the tip of his finger in water and cool my tongue; because I am tormented by this flame!’
25 “Abrahaam garuu akkana jedhee deebise; ‘Yaa ilma ko, ati bara jireenya keetiitti waan gaarii akka argatte, Alʼaazaar immoo waan hamaa akka argate yaadadhu; amma garuu asitti isatti toleera; ati immoo dhiphachaa jirta.
But Abraham said: ‘Child, remember that in your lifetime you received your good things, while Lazarus had bad things; but now he is being comforted, and you tormented.
26 Waan kana hunda irrattis, akka warri nu biraa gara keessan dhufuu barbaadan dhufuu hin dandeenyeef yookaan akka warri isin biraa gara keenyatti ceʼuu hin dandeenyeef nuu fi isin gidduu boolla guddaatu jira.’
And besides all this, between us and you a great chasm has been fixed, so that those who want to pass from here to you cannot, nor can anyone from there cross over to us.’
27 “Dureessi sunis akkana jedhee deebise; ‘Yoos yaa Abbaa, akka ati gara mana abbaa kootti Alʼaazaarin naa ergitu sin kadhadha;
Then he said, ‘I beg you therefore, father, that you would send him to my father's house,
28 ani obboloota shan qabaatii; akka isaanis iddoo dhiphinaa kana hin dhufneef inni dhaqee isaan haa akeekkachiisu.’
because I have five brothers, so that he may testify to them, lest they also come to this place of torment.’
29 “Abrahaam garuu, ‘Isaan Musee fi raajota qabu; isaanuma haa dhagaʼan’ jedhe.
Abraham said to him, ‘They have Moses and the prophets; let them hear them.’
30 “Dureessichis, ‘Akkas miti; yaa abbaa koo Abrahaam; yoo warra duʼan keessaa namni tokko gara isaanii dhaqe garuu, isaan qalbii ni jijjiirratu’ jedheen.
So he said to him, ‘Oh no, father Abraham—if someone from the dead should go to them, they will repent!’
31 “Abrahaamis, ‘Isaan yoo Musee fi raajota hin dhageenye, yoo namni tokko warra duʼan keessaa kaʼe illee hin amanan’ jedheen.”
He said to him, ‘If they do not listen to Moses and the prophets, they will not be persuaded even if someone should rise from the dead.’”
